Toman
Now based in Amsterdam, he moved to the Dutch capital in early 2018 — and has barely had time to pause for breath since. A producer who boasts an impressively prolific streak, Toman started his musical journey at an early age. More recently, his unique take on house and techno has led him to much-renowned outlets such as We R House, Cyclic, META, No Art, PIV, Blind Vision and Inermu, yet Toman’s story is no overnight success. On the contrary, his is one that that’s as attributable to a ceaseless work ethic as it is a music-loving upbringing and an unyielding appreciation of sound. Fascinated by all things percussion, Toman began learning the drums in his early teens, a move that would eventually steer him toward what he considers the “unrestrictive complexities of electronic music”. A producer with an endlessly eclectic palette, Toman cites the likes of Underworld, Minilogue, and Terry Lee Brown Jr as influences, all of whom attest in some way to his own eclectic palette. From minimal to tech-house to house and deeper sounds, Toman’s diverse musical outlook is refreshingly hard to categorise. In 2017, Toman’s first solo EP arrived courtesy of Mihai Popoviciu’s much-respected Cyclic. An ear-catching release that introduced us to a prodigious young talent, it was an impressive sign of things to come. Toman also signed his debut vinyl EP to Cinthie’s much-loved we_r house label, with the Broodrooster EP supported by a diverse cast of globally-respected DJs such as Archie Hamilton, Terry Francis, Roger Gerressen, Rossko, Dorian Paic, Traumer, Alexi Delano and Eric Cloutier. Added to this, his track, ‘Fantanized’ (released via the much-respected No Art label) spent over two months at the top on Beatport. In between studio sessions, Toman continues to tour as a DJ, with bookings outside of his native country including stop-offs in Uruguay, Argentina, Sydney (where he played the globally-renowned SASH party), Berlin’s Watergate and Leipzig’s Distillery - as well as jaunts to Zurich, Manchester and Bucharest to name a few. Closer to home, Toman’s stock continues to rise, with high-profile bookings at the likes of Awakenings and Straf_werk Festival emphasizing his growing stature in the game. KOKO (IT)
With a unique approach to his craft and a passion that runs deep, it is by no chance that the creative mind that is KOKO has grown in leaps and bounds since releasing his first work in his teenage years. His no nonsense approach to house music gained him recognition from many international crews, including the illustrious Fuse camp in London. Since embracing this connection with the brand in 2015, the budding Italian artist has had the pleasure of releasing some of his music through the Fuse outlet, starting with his 'Generation K' EP on Infuse in 2019. Other endeavours in the world of productions include 'Sexy Vibe '98' on OLDiVIBES, as well as his independently released work, which have generated masses of hype - notably his rework entitled 'Mostrami Come'. Leading names that have continuously supported the youngsters work ranges from Jamie Jones, Richy Ahmed and Nastia to Raresh, Barac and DeWalta, as well as the likes of Enzo, Archie Hamilton and the Fuse crew in its entirety. KOKO's international profile outside of the studio has also continuously risen in recent years, allowing him to light up some of the globes hotspots with his energetic and intellegentsets. Germany, Holland and the UK have had the joy of hosting for this trailblazer at reputable clubs such as Studio 338 and 93 Feet East as well as Zero11 and other clubs in his home country. BizZa
Sergio Bizarro, better known in the electronic scene under his aka BizZa, is a DJ and producer from Madrid currently based in Badajoz, Extremadura. From a very early age, the artist was greatly influenced by old school, hip-hop and house sounds. Over the years, he has been shaping and perfecting his sound and today he manages to give his sessions a unique touch with rhythms full of groove, exotic vocals and a lot of energy. Today, BizZa has shared a booth with great artists in the industry such as Luciano, Joseph Capriati, Dennis Cruz, Andrea Oliva, Cuartero, Hector Couto, Rafa Barrios, Melanie Ribbe, Neverdogs, Ale de Tuglie, WADE, Karotte, Viviana Casanova , Chelina Manuhutu, Bastian Bux, Rendher, Jhon Digweed, Artman, Deborah de Luca among many others. The man from Madrid has traveled different continents, taking his sound to some of the best clubs and festivals on the music scene such as Lost Beach Club (Ecuador), Viuz, (Medellín, Colombia), Switch Club (Rosario, Argentina), Casona de Camaná (Lima, Peru) Fabrik (Madrid), Pacha Barcelona, Industrial Copera (Granada), Ayuntamiento (Barcelona), Riviera (Madrid), Cosmos (Seville), Esgremi (Mallorca), Café del Mar (Torre del Mar) or Palladium Club (Málaga) ), playing on top brands such as Brunch Electronik, Sight, Rebels, Intro, Cocoa, Electronic Play Ground, Extremusika, Code World Tour, Hebben Live and more. Currently, BizZa has signed his music to major international labels such as Moan Records, elrow Music, Sanity, Deeperfet, Viva Music, MÜSE, MoodChilld, Issues, Organic Pieces, Family Partner, Roush Label, Clarisse, Take Notes, La Pera, Ball Park, Futura . and Drumma Records among others. Although he has only been producing for a short time—since 2020—his productions have received the support of industry heavyweights such as Jamie Jones, Marco Carola, Cuartero, Dennis Cruz, Ilario Alicante, Loco Dice, Paco Osuna, Skream, Luciano, Classmatic , Wheats, Latmun, Yaya, Blondish, Neverdogs, Manda Moor, Eddy M, Hector Couto, Stacey Pullen, De La Swing, The Martinez Brothers, Michael Bibi or Hot Since 82 among many others. His sound is constantly evolving and he is always open to collaborating with artists in the studio. As if that were not enough, BizZa is also the owner of his own label Ohana Music Label, a label that he merges with his own promoter Ohana House Parties.
